Adelaide Convention Centre

The venue for the ASM is the Adelaide Convention Centre, conveniently located in the heart of the city centre and nestled within the beauty of the Riverbank Precinct, surrounded by parklands and the River Torrens.

Close proximity to the medical hub, entertainment, cultural and sport precinct, the Centre is a short walk to international and boutique hotels and accommodation. Public transport, the Adelaide Railway Station and a taxi ramp are on our doorstep.

The Adelaide Convention Centre opened its doors in 1987 and has been constantly evolving and improving with three major extensions in less than 30 years. They enjoy a global reputation for excellence earning a string of awards and recently completed the new West Building and renovation of the East Building.

Adelaide has had many nicknames over the years, from “the Athens of the south” (a nod to the Mediterranean climate and lifestyle) to “the 20-minute city” (because getting around just isn’t a problem). Adelaide is also known as Australia’s home to great food, the arts and new ideas.

It’s an easy city to enjoy, whether you prefer 5-star dining, quirky laneway bars, exploring the bustling Central Market, cycling in the parklands, strolling in the picturesque Adelaide Hills or relaxing on a stretch of white sandy beach just 20 minutes (that figure again) from the CBD.
